Originally Posted by whoozyadaddy7
Guys: Random and slightly noobish question. Ok so you have all seen my drop. It's low, but still on stock body so it isn't ridiculously crazy by any means. Where do you guys go to get alignments? I've been turned down at a couple places cause they say it won't get up the ramps lol. Thanks in advance!
what location? around here, theres only 2 shops i know of that have a drive on rack. and then theres the dealer

Originally Posted by whoozyadaddy7
Oh really? :/ I'm in AZ, Tucson now to be specific. I didn't figure anyone could actually tell me a place, I guess I was just was wondering if there were actually places to accommodate a drop haha. I tried the dealer today and they said no go. Looks like this set of tires is going bye bye pretty quick.
nah theres gotta be a shop near you that can do it. just call around and ask if anyone has an "in-ground" alignment rack. most of the newer Hunter machines are inground. usually nissan and infiniti dealerships are the first ones to get them too.
